Touko stood on the deck of the boat, breathing in deep. The salty tinge of the air from the ocean tickled her nose, her long brown hair blowing back from her face. Her trademark hat was off, sitting in her room on the ship.
She had been on this boat for a good few days, on her way to a new place. The Johto region. It was the first time she'd left Unova, though she had embarked on her Pokemon journey over seven years ago. Excitement flared anew as her blue eyes caught sight of land, so near.
Touko had taken a bit of a break from Pokemon, after she beat the Elite Four. Well, sort-of beat them, really. N, of Team Plasma, had challenged her from the very beginning of her journey. She had believed him to be a tentative friend until he was revealed the be the King of Team Plasma. He had pushed her, and the Unova Gym Leaders had helped her. She obtained Reshiram, a powerful Legendary, and was forced to battle. Touko, then about 11, had won. N had fled the scene afterwards, and that was all anyone had heard since, aside from someone hearing he was spotted "in a far off land."
From there, she continued to train, checking out the rest of Unova, exploring every inch of the land that she could, catching Pokemon and meeting people, but never overstressing herself. Finally, around the time Touko was 15, she finally challenged the Elite Four once more, winning but never accepting the title of Champion. Cheren came around right after her, winning and taking Alder's place as Champion.
And then she took another break..staying at home with her mother, mostly, for the next two years. She did go off occasionally,often to visit Lacunosa or Castelia for the fun of it. Finally, right after her 17th birthday, it was as if Touko woke up needing change. She asked around, and found a ship to go to Johto- that was it. That was the way to go. She boarded as soon as she could, and now, here she was.
Her Team had changed significantly over the years, Emboar still being a central Pokemon, and one of the only two she had on her right now. The other was her Scrafty, and all of her other Pokemon were stored away safely in her PC. Except Reshiram- who she had released willingly, though she'd see glimpses of it occasionally. She had plenty of Pokeballs in her bag...she wanted to meet new Pokemon. Catch some more.
"Olivine City!" A Sailor announced as the Ship finally came to Port. A short time later, the brunette teenager was stepping slightly shakily off the boat, and into Olivine City of the Johto Region. She walked through the city at a leisurely pace, looking at everything. So incredibly different from Unova. The buildings were so different, the feel was so much more comfortable, home-like.
Touko stopped in front of the Lighthouse, the sign reading Glitter lighthouse. Her blue eyes lit up as she stared upwards at the towering building, making mental note to tour that later. For now? She headed to the Mart, to stock up on the usuals (Full Restores, Full Heals) and then stepped outside, stretching her long, pale arms backwards. The salty smell of the air was so relaxing, the Sun was warm, thought the light was dimming. She tossed Emboar's pokeball into the air, and in a flash of red light, the large Pokemon was standing in front of her.
"C'mon, let's go see if the Pokemon Center has any spare rooms." Touko said with a grin, looking out to the Horizon, where the sun was beginning to sink. Emboar grunted in approval.
She strolled down the small road, Emboar following closely. An unusual green Pokemon with a long neck that had a large pink flower around it had stopped, Trainer-less sniffing Emboar. Touko whipped out her Pokedex, opening it.
"Magenium," the voice said. "Its breath has the fantastic ability to revive dead plants and flowers."
Emboar was staring at the Meganium, who crowed it's name loudly. It looked friendly, but why was there no Trainer? A small, decorated string was around Meganium's leg, indicating it had a trainer.
"Hey, come on big guy, let's find your Trainer." Touko said softly, catching the Grass Pokemon's attention. She turned to walk into the Pokemon center, the automated door flying open- walking straight into a very familiar, pale green haired man.
The man, taller and more filled out than he was seven years ago, laughed slightly. "I knew Meganium felt happy, and only one person I have ever met has made Pokemon feel like that so quickly," He said. "Hello, Touko."
Touko backed up a few steps, blue eyes flying wide open. Emboar even turned, growling her name is recognition. "N!" She exclaimed, hand flying to her chest. "Wow. I never knew I would see you here!"
